How much do inventory j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 5, 2026, the average hourly pay for inventory in Spring Hill, FL is $17.38,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.47 and $18.37 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Inventory vs Warehouse Associate?

AspectInventoryWarehouse Associate
Primary RoleManaging stock levels, tracking inventory, and overseeing inventory accuracyHandling goods, packing, shipping, and assisting in warehouse operations
Required SkillsInventory management, data entry, organizational skillsPhysical stamina, forklift operation, basic logistics
Work EnvironmentOffice-based with warehouse oversightPhysical warehouse setting
CertificationsInventory management systems, sometimes forklift certificationForklift certification often required

While both roles are integral to warehouse operations, Inventory focuses on stock control and accuracy, whereas Warehouse Associates handle the physical movement and management of goods. What are some common challenges faced by inventory professionals, and how can they be addressed?

Inventory professionals often encounter challenges such as maintaining accurate stock levels, managing discrepancies, and adapting to fluctuating demand. These issues can be mitigated by implementing robust inventory management systems, conducting regular cycle counts, and fostering clear communication with purchasing and sales teams. Staying organized and proactive in identifying potential shortages or overstock situations helps ensure smooth operations and minimizes costly errors.

What are inventory jobs?

Inventory jobs involve managing, tracking, and organizing a company's stock of goods or materials. People in these roles ensure that inventory levels are accurate, products are stored properly, and supplies are ordered or restocked as needed. Typical duties may include receiving shipments, conducting stock counts, updating inventory databases, and coordinating with other departments to fulfill orders. Inventory jobs exist in a variety of industries, including retail, manufacturing, and logistics. These positions are essential for maintaining efficient operations and preventing shortages or overstock situations.
